What Will You Find out in an Infant First Aid Course?

An Infant First Aid Course generally covers the complying with subjects:

Basic Life Support (BLS) Understanding just how to acknowledge when an infant needs CPR. Learning appropriate breast compression strategies for infants. Choking Relief Techniques How to determine choking signs. Performing back impacts and upper body drives correctly. Managing Common Emergencies Treatment for burns, cuts, high temperatures, and allergic reactions. Guidelines on how to respond to poisoning incidents. Mental Wellness First Aid Recognizing anxiety signals in both babies and parents. Techniques for advertising emotional well-being. Manual Handling Techniques Safely lifting and bring your infant throughout emergencies. First Help Tools Familiarization What should be consisted of in your home first aid kit.

Each program may differ slightly; nonetheless, these core areas are universally recognized as critical elements of any kind of baby first aid training program.

Key Methods: DRSABCD Framework

One important facet showed in infant first aid training courses is the DRSABCD framework:

D-- Risk: Look for any type of risk to on your own or others. R-- Action: Analyze if the baby reacts by carefully drinking their shoulders or calling their name. S-- Send for Aid: Call emergency solutions immediately if there's no response. A-- Respiratory tract: Open up the air passage using a head tilt-chin lift technique. B-- Breathing: Look for typical breathing patterns within 10 seconds. C-- Compressions: Otherwise taking a breath normally, commence upper body compressions quickly at a rate of 100-120 compressions per minute. D-- Defibrillation: Make use of an AED if available as soon as experienced workers arrive.

This systematic method simplifies emergency feedbacks and guarantees clarity during high-stress situations.
